Overview
DS1052U-100 from Maxim Integrated (now part of Analog Devices) is a 5-bit programmable pulse-width modulator IC with fixed 100kHz output frequency, 2-wire serial interface, and 8-pin SOP (118-mil) package. It delivers adjustable duty cycle from 0% to 100% across 2.7V–5.5V supply, draws 100µA active current and 1µA shutdown current, and operates from –40°C to +85°C - ideal for LCD contrast control and low-power voltage adjustment.
For engineers reviewing the DS1052U-100 datasheet, DS1052U-100 pinout, DS1052U-100 application, or DS1052U-100 equivalent, key selection considerations include its 5-bit resolution (3.125% step size), I²C-compatible 2-wire slave interface with A0–A2 address pins, 100kHz nominal PWM frequency with ±20% tolerance, and space-saving 8-pin SOP footprint.
Technical Context
The DS1052U-100 implements a dedicated 5-bit PWM generator with internal oscillator set to 100kHz; it does not support frequency programming. Its 2-wire interface operates in both standard (100kHz) and fast (400kHz) modes, supporting up to eight devices on one bus via hardware-addressed A0–A2 pins.
Control logic accepts an 8-bit command byte followed by an 8-bit data byte: five LSBs configure duty cycle (00000B = 0%, 11111B = 96.88%), while three MSBs manage shutdown/recall. The PWMO output swings rail-to-rail (0V to VCC) and enters high-impedance state during shutdown.

What is the exact PWM frequency tolerance of the DS1052U-100?
The DS1052U-100 has a nominal output frequency of 100kHz with a specified tolerance of ±20% over the full operating temperature range (–40°C to +85°C) and supply voltage (2.7V to 5.5V). This variation arises from process and voltage dependencies in the internal oscillator; actual measured frequency falls within 80kHz to 120kHz under worst-case conditions.
Does the DS1052U-100 support true 100% duty cycle, and how is it activated?
Yes, the DS1052U-100 supports true 100% duty cycle ("full-on") via a dedicated command sequence distinct from its standard 5-bit register write. Writing 0x00 to the PWM register yields 0%; writing 0x1F yields 96.88%; only the "Set PWM Duty Cycle 100%" command (control byte 0x50, data byte 0x40) forces PWMO to remain continuously high - essential for enabling power rails or bypassing regulation.
How many DS1052U-100 devices can share the same 2-wire bus?
Up to eight DS1052U-100 devices can operate on a single 2-wire bus, enabled by the A0, A1, and A2 address pins which configure a unique 3-bit slave address (0101xxx). Each device must have a distinct combination tied to VCC or GND; no external address decoder is needed, and all share the same SCL/SDA lines and pull-up resistors.
What is the maximum capacitive load the DS1052U-100 SDA and SCL pins can drive?
The DS1052U-100 SDA and SCL pins are open-drain outputs rated for standard and fast I²C modes, with a maximum bus capacitance of 400pF per line. This limit applies to total trace + device + connector capacitance; exceeding it risks timing violations (e.g., tR/tF degradation), especially at 400kHz. External pull-ups should be selected per I²C specification based on bus speed and load.
Can the DS1052U-100 operate from a 3.3V supply, and what is its typical active current at that voltage?
Yes, the DS1052U-100 fully supports 3.3V operation within its 2.7V–5.5V range. At 3.3V and +25°C, typical active supply current is 100µA - matching the value specified at 5.0V. This consistency across voltage makes DS1052U-100 suitable for mixed-voltage systems without performance trade-offs.
